Gentle Reminder About Alt-Text
Remember FediFriends that alt-text actually has a function and should be describing the media you are including in your post.
Please refrain from just writing "image" or "gif" or anything similar (yes I have seen this regularly, and worse).
It's okay if the description is short,
but please write what the media actually represents. For example: "Photo of a tabby cat sitting on a couch."
This is important for accessibility đ
